Movie S2.

Three-dimensional reddening of peripherally engrafted CX3CR1+ monocytes engulfing β3-tubulin+ neuronal tissue 20 weeks after ocular injury. There dimensional rendering of confocal scans showing peripherally engrafted CX3CR1+ cells (semitransparent green) engulfing β3-tubulin+ cells (red) 20 weeks after acute ocular surface injury (right video panel). In contrast, CX3CR1+ microglia of naive eye do not engulf nor internalize β3-tubulin+ tissue, although they come in contact with β3-tubulin+ tissue (left video panel).
